Transaction 01251a9e3ab4843681ad325bed981a53cef429a95ccc71e6d8b7e8f1b2aa23b8
1 Input
1 Outputs
- 01251a9e3ab4843681ad325bed981a53cef429a95ccc71e6d8b7e8f1b2aa23b8:0
value 9696270
address 33DjVDHSRE6FSk12pgwvD5dTeZPg1JAbxr